commit:     bbdf11c13e8f40b8791d7aed9a4f144bdb89cd85
Author:     Zero_Chaos <zerochaos <AT> gentoo <DOT> org>
AuthorDate: Mon Mar 14 18:11:12 2016 +0000
Commit:     Richard Farina <zerochaos <AT> gentoo <DOT> org>
CommitDate: Mon Mar 14 18:11:12 2016 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=bbdf11c1

net-wireless/kismet: add tinfo patch to 2016.01.1

Package-Manager: portage-2.2.27

 net-wireless/kismet/files/kismet-2016.01.1-tinfo.patch | 11 +++++++++++
 net-wireless/kismet/kismet-2016.01.1.ebuild            |  2 ++
 2 files changed, 13 insertions(+)

diff --git a/net-wireless/kismet/files/kismet-2016.01.1-tinfo.patch 
b/net-wireless/kismet/files/kismet-2016.01.1-tinfo.patch
new file mode 100644
index 0000000..6294c80
--- /dev/null
+++ b/net-wireless/kismet/files/kismet-2016.01.1-tinfo.patch
@@ -0,0 +1,11 @@
+--- a/configure.ac
++++ b/configure.ac
+@@ -423,6 +423,8 @@
+                                foundlcurses=yes curseaux="-lcurses" 
termcontrol="curses" )
+       fi
+ 
++      AC_SEARCH_LIBS([stdscr], tinfo ncurses,curseaux="$curseaux $ac_res")
++
+       if test "$foundlcurses" != "yes"; then
+               AC_MSG_ERROR(Failed to find libcurses or libncurses.  Install 
them or disable building the Kismet client with --disable-client.  Disabling 
the client is probably not something you want to do normally.)
+       fi

diff --git a/net-wireless/kismet/kismet-2016.01.1.ebuild 
b/net-wireless/kismet/kismet-2016.01.1.ebuild
index 403a75f..596d8ab 100644
--- a/net-wireless/kismet/kismet-2016.01.1.ebuild
+++ b/net-wireless/kismet/kismet-2016.01.1.ebuild
@@ -51,6 +51,8 @@ RDEPEND="${CDEPEND}
 "
 
 src_prepare() {
+       epatch "${FILESDIR}"/${P}-tinfo.patch
+
        sed -i -e "s:^\(logtemplate\)=\(.*\):\1=/tmp/\2:" \
                conf/kismet.conf.in
 

Reply via email to